## Account Recovery: Parity Dashboard Access

Support agents comparing feature parity between the Larkfield SDKs (Swift and Kotlin builds) use the parity dashboard. If an agent's dashboard account is locked, verify their support roster entry, then reset access using the shared recovery passphrase. The current passphrase is listed below.

vault phrase of taweg-kafof = oliax-zorael

Leadership Review Briefing — Customer Concentration

Heads of department: Brinmore Logistics now represents 41% of Tarsen Works revenue, up from 28% last year. Loss of this account would breach covenant thresholds within two quarters. Mitigation: accelerate the Pellway pipeline and cap Brinmore discounting. Targets to be set at Thursday's review. Our response plan is outlined in the confidential note below.

board note of fahaf-fahop: Gross margin on Wenix came in at 10 percent against a plan of 15 percent. Only 9 of the 80 pilot accounts renewed Wenix, so a churn review is set for April 1.

## Build provenance: cron → Loomrunner

Quick note for the sync: we're migrating the old crontab jobs on the Haverstock box into Loomrunner workflows so every run gets provenance attached. Nightly exports and the stats rollup are done; cleanup jobs land next week. Each migrated workflow now stamps its output, and the first verified run's token appears below.

pipeline stamp: htk21_86b657ac0aa916a9af17f